starring
/ˈstɑrɪŋ/
adjective
- Having the main role or being the most important performer in a movie, play, or show.
- The starring actor gave an amazing performance in the new film.
- The movie features a starring cast of well-known actors.
- She landed the starring role in the school play.

preposition
- Used to indicate the main performer or performers in a movie, play, or show.
- I watched a documentary starring a famous scientist.
- The new comedy, starring two famous comedians, opens next week.
- The play, starring a local theater group, was a big success.
verb
- Present participle of 'star' — to perform as the main actor or performer in a movie, play, or show.
- They are starring together in a romantic comedy.
- The young actor has been starring in television shows since he was a child.
- She is starring in a new action movie this summer.
